Should You Sell Your Investment Property This Spring?

Eppraisal

If you are a real estate investment property owner, you should have a professional analysis performed each year. A licensed real estate agent can perform the analysis to determine how much your property is worth and if your monthly rent is in line with market value rents. Considering selling?

Purchasing & Developing Land - Part 5 - Reselling It - Raw or Developed

Eppraisal

While some purchase vacant property to build their dream house and later occupy it, many others see raw land as a profitable investment. If the lot is zoned for commercial use, they do well to develop it as a retail space or other business, and later serving as the landlord.

What is a Commercial Real Estate Appraisal?

AmeriMac

These appraisals are considered equivalent to a property valuation and are used to determine the value of the property in the current market. Overall, a commercial real estate appraisal is a crucial step in the process of buying or investing in an income-generating property.
